JS, obrazy i CSS przechwytywane przez HTTPModule

Mam prosty moduł HTTPModule, który wykonuje niestandardowe zarządzanie stanem sesji.

public void Init(HttpApplication context)
        {
            context.AcquireRequestState += new EventHandler(ProcessBeginRequest);
            ActivityLogger.LogInfo( DateTime.UtcNow.ToLongTimeString() + " In Init " + HttpContext.Current.Request.Url.AbsoluteUri);
        }

i

public void ProcessBeginRequest(object sender, EventArgs e)
        {
            HttpApplication application = sender as HttpApplication;
            ActivityLogger.LogInfo(DateTime.UtcNow.ToLongTimeString() + " In ProcessBeginRequest ");
            if (application != null)
            {
                string requestURL = application.Context.Request.Url.ToString();
                ActivityLogger.LogInfo(DateTime.UtcNow.ToLongTimeString() + " In ProcessBeginRequest " + requestURL);
            }
            return;
        }

Kiedy uruchomiłem ten kod z punktami przerwania, zobaczyłem, że ten moduł został wywołany nawet dla statycznych plików, takich jak obrazy, js i css. Czy ktoś to doświadczył? Myślę, że moduły HTTP tylko zaczepiały się o zdarzenia w potoku http dla stron asp.net. Czy podłączają się również do zasobów statycznych? A może tylko z cassini?

Środowisko: VS2008 - serwer cassini

PS: Próbowałem go z Win2k8 IIS7 w naszej piaskownicy (trochę nowy) i próbowałem zapisać go w pliku dziennika (ponieważ nie mamy tam VS), ale nie mogłem zapisać do pliku dziennika. Jestem pewien, że niektóre uprawnienia do zapisu. Czy ktoś może wskazać mi jakiś zasób, który mówi mi, jak ustawić uprawnienia do zapisu dla katalogów podczas uruchamiania ASP.net z IIS7 w W2k8

Edit1: Rozumiem, że używanie zintegrowanego rurociągu rozszerzyłoby potoki http zarówno o statyczne, jak i zarządzane zasobyhttp://aspnet.4guysfromrolla.com/articles/122408-1.aspx ihttp://learn.iis.net/page.aspx/243/aspnet-integration-with-iis7/

W naszym produkcie używamy klasycznego rurociągu. Ale nadal zainteresowany wiedzą, czego doświadczyli inni ludzie.

Pytanie 2: Czy przy użyciu IIS7 w trybie zintegrowanym zmniejszy wydajność? Powiedzmy, że masz kilka modułów podłączonych do rurociągu, jak duży byłby wpływ na wydajność? Byłoby miło, gdyby ktoś mógł wskazać mi niektóre badania bazowe wykonane w tym celu.

questionAnswers(2)

yourAnswerToTheQuestion